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.08.18;
Скачать: CL | DM;

Вниз

как добавить новую запись в базу   Найти похожие ветки 

 
Inst   (2003-07-23 18:41) [0]

так что бы она была записана в алфавитном порядке, т.е
в баде допустить есть 2 записи
1
3
после добавление записи со значением "2" должно выдаваться при чтении (без сортировки, сразу)
1
2
3


 
Jeer ©   (2003-07-23 18:58) [1]

Эт задача решается позаписным копированием в нужном порядке в новую таблицу.
Но так не делают:)

Для увеличения скорости выборки используются индексы.


 
Anatoly Podgoretsky ©   (2003-07-23 19:03) [2]

И для этого в АПИ есть поддержка dbiSortTable
А сразу никак не получится, поскольку эта задача решается только полной перезаписью таблицы, лучше использовать индексы, как положено это в приличном обществе, или технологию клиент-сервер, в лице ее представителя SQL тогда и индексы необязательны.


 
Inst   (2003-07-23 19:24) [3]

спасибо, а как можно использовать индексы для сортировки (в прямом и обратном порядке) на клиенте? (TClientDataSet)



Страницы: 1 вся ветка

Текущий архив: 2003.08.18;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.01 c
14-58393
Infinity
2002-12-14 15:35
2003.08.18
Как спрятать Программу в TrayBar ?


14-58443
brainstorm
2003-08-02 17:39
2003.08.18
Как зделать так что бы моя программа не светилась по ALT+CTRL+DEL


14-58466
Julliete
2003-07-23 17:35
2003.08.18
Удаление всех записей из таблицы


14-58488
alextov
2003-07-23 15:16
2003.08.18
Проблемы со скриптами во FreeReport 2.23


14-58429
VID
2003-08-02 17:02
2003.08.18
Ограничение в 65536 символов в RichEdit